Friday golf will be played at JW Marriott Phoenix Desert Ridge Golf Course. Saturday's golf tournaments will be played at the Stadium Course at TPC Scottsdale.

As the PGA TOUR stop with the largest crowds of any golf event in the world, The WM Phoenix Open brings immeasurable attention and respect to the Stadium Course, designed by the team of Tom Weiskopf and Jay Morrish. The course, which was renovated in 2014, is most famous for its par-3, 16th hole that transforms into “The Coliseum” during the tournaments and provides fans with one of the most exciting settings in professional sports.

During the 51 weeks of the year when fans are not watching the sport’s top names make history, they can test their own skills on the same pristine fairways – maintained to PGA TOUR-quality standards year-round – as their favorite professionals.
